「実行可能性」とはどういう意味ですか?
目次
実行性っていうのは、何かを実際に実行できるかどうかを表すかっこいい言葉なんだ。プログラミングの世界では、通常はエラーなしで実行できるコードを指すよ。レシピに例えるなら、指示が意味不明だったり重要なステップが抜けてたりすると、ケーキがパンケーキみたいになっちゃうかも。実行可能なコードは、美味しい料理を作るためのよく書かれたレシピみたいなもんだ!
実行性が大事な理由
ソフトウェアを作るとき、コードが紙の上でだけ働くんじゃなくて、実際に正しく機能することがめっちゃ大事なんだ。もしコードが実行できないと、ソフトウェアがクラッシュしたり、機能が全然働かなかったり、いろんな頭痛の種を引き起こすことになる。友達に電話しようとしたら、彼の声じゃなくて雑音しか聞こえないみたいな感じ。楽しくないよね?
コンテキストが実行性に与える影響
いい会話と同じように、コンテキストが大事!コーディングでは、コンテキストっていうのはコードが何をすべきかを明確にするための周りの情報のこと。開発者がコードを書くとき、プログラムやデータの他の部分に頼ることが多いんだ。もしコードがコンテキストを欠いてると、ちゃんと実行するのが難しくなる。まるで、材料が何かわからないまま料理しようとするみたいなもんだよ。
実行性を高めるための戦略
コードの実行性を向上させるためのテクニックはいくつかあるよ。一つの方法は、クリアなガイドラインや指示を提供することで、モデルがコンテキストともっと上手く働くのを助けること。別のアプローチは、コードがどれだけうまく実行できるかを評価するツールを使うこと。これは、自分の料理の傑作を出す前に味見をする人を雇うようなもんだね。
実行性と妥当性のバランス
実行性が大事なのはもちろんだけど、それだけじゃないんだ。妥当性っていうのは、コードが単に動くだけじゃなくて、期待通りのことをするかどうかを指すから。これって、ケーキが見た目だけじゃなくて、味もいいか確認するのに似てるよね。だから、実行性と妥当性のバランスを見つけるのが開発者には重要で、ユーザーがちゃんと動く製品を手に入れられるようにしなきゃなんだ。
結論
要するに、実行性っていうのは、コードがスムーズに動くかどうかを確保することなんだ。コンテキストに気を配って、効果的な戦略を使うことで、開発者は信頼性のあるソフトウェアを作れるよ。誰だってそんなのが欲しいよね?結局、うまく実行されたコードが成功するプログラムの秘密の食材なんだから!